@font-face {
    font-family:'BentonSans-Bk';
    font-weight: 300;
    src: url("/content/dam/amex/au/business/business-credit-cards/merchant-offer/styles/BentonSans-Book.ttf") format("truetype"), url("/content/dam/amex/au/business/business-credit-cards/merchant-offer/styles/BentonSans-Book.eot") format("embedded-opentype"),
        url("/content/dam/amex/au/business/business-credit-cards/merchant-offer/styles/BentonSans-Book.woff") format("woff"), url("/content/dam/amex/sg/business/credit-cards/singapore-airline-card/font/FontBureau-BentonSans-Book.otf") format("opentype");
}
/*tnc*/
.TnC .collapsible.accordion-toggle.flex-align-center.dls-accent-white-01-bg {text-align:center;}
.TnC .dls-accent-gray-01-bg, .dls-accent-gray-01-bg-hvr:hover {
    background-color: #ffffff !important;
}

.TnC  .collapsible:focus {
    outline: none !important;
    
}
.TnC .accordion.border.open {
  border: 1px solid #fff;
}
.TnC .accordion.border {
    border: 1px solid white;
}
.TnC .collapsible.accordion-toggle.flex-align-center.dls-accent-white-01-bg {
    background-color: white;
}
.TnC .accordion-content.container-fluid.dls-accent-gray-01-bg.border-lr.border-b {
    border-left: 1px solid white;
    border-bottom: 1px solid white;
    border-right: 1px solid white;
}
div.btn-grid a{
font-size:14px;
}
div.btm-brdr-grid{
    border-bottom: 1px solid #d6d7d8;
}
div.app-grid .pad{
padding:0rem!important;
}
div.pad.text-align-left.img-no-pad {
    padding: 0rem !important;
}
.bg-white {
    background-color: white;
}
@media only screen and (max-width: 767px) {
div#hero-module {
    min-height: 380px;
    
}
div.icon-grid  .row{
display:table;
}
div.icon-grid  .col-md-1{
display:table-cell;
}
div.app-grid   .row{
display:table;
}
div.app-grid   .col-md-4{
display:table-cell;
}
div.mobile-top-margin{
margin-top:1rem;
}


}

@media (min-width: 768px) {
}